Director of Data Governance and Engineering
Confidential, Overland Park
POSITION SUMMARY:We are seeking a highly skilled and experienced Director of Data Governance and Engineering to lead our data management initiatives and engineering efforts. This pivotal role will be responsible for establishing and maintaining robust data governance frameworks, ensuring data quality, integrity, and security across the organization. The ideal candidate will possess a strong background in both data governance principles and engineering practices, with the ability to drive innovation, streamline processes, and maximize the value derived from data assets.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:Develop and implement data governance strategies, policies, and procedures to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ements and industry best practices.Establish data governance frameworks, including data standards, metadata management, data lineage, and data stewardship programs.Collaborate with cross-functional teams to define data ownership, access controls, and data lifecycle management processes.Lead efforts to monitor and enforce data governance policies, addressing issues related to data quality, consistency, and privacy.Provide strategic direction and oversight for the design, development, and maintenance of data engineering solutions and infrastructure.Manage a team of data engineers, architects, and analysts, fostering a culture of collaboration, innovation, and continuous improvement.Architect scalable and efficient data pipelines, data warehouses, and analytics platforms to support the organization's data-driven initiatives.Evaluate and implement emerging technologies and tools to enhance data processing, integration, and visualization capabilities.Partner with business leaders, IT stakeholders, and data users to understand requirements and prioritize data governance and engineering initiatives.Collaborate with legal, compliance, and security teams to ensure data governance practices align with regulatory requirements and cybersecurity protocols.Engage with internal and external stakeholders to communicate data governance policies, initiatives, and achievements effectively.All other duties as assignedJOB QUALIFICATIONS AND REQUIREMENTS:Bachelor's or Master's deg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, or related field.Proven experience (10+ years) in data governance, data management, and data engineering roles, with a track record of successful leadership and project delivery and 5+ years leading peopleIn-depth knowledge of data governance principles, regulatory requirements (e.g., GDPR, CCPA), and industry standards (e.g., DAMA).Strong proficiency in data engineering technologies and tools, including ETL/ELT processes, SQL, data modeling, and cloud-based data platforms (e.g., AWS, Azure, GCP).Experience with data governance and engineering frameworks (e.g., Collibra, Informatica, Apache Hadoop, Spark).Excellent communication, interpersonal, and leadership sk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ively across teams and influence stakeholders at all levels.
Practice Manager - Secure Endpoint | Remote, USA
Optiv Security, Overland Park
The Practice Manager is responsible for technical leadership and personnel management of a service delivery practice area within one of the consulting services divisions. The Practice Manager ensures that appropriate methodologies are in place, current and enforced for the execution of the services aligned under the practice division. The Practice Manager also provides delivery quality oversight from a technical and leadership perspective to include enforcement of the defined methodologies as well as preliminary deliverable review to ensure content is appropriate, comprehensive and addresses the requirements of the project. How you'll make an impact:Act as the primary leader of the Endpoint Security consulting practice with responsibility of day to day leadership and collaborating with Senior practice leadership on initiatives and strategies. Responsible for overall client lifecycle management from sales to delivery. Management and oversight of a workgroup/function with a responsibility to develop team members to perform at a higher level by giving opportunities, providing timely continuous feedback, and communicating expectations. (Ensure your team of Consultants are trained and enabled to meet the growing needs of our clients, and are meeting or exceeding their individual billable utilization targets.)Ensure testing, analysis and/or approach methodologies for all relevant service offerings are documented, updated and enforceable across the consultants within the group. Provide preliminary and comprehensive review of project deliverables to ensure content is appropriate and address the requirements of the project as defined in the statement of work and as desired by the customer. The Practice Manager is responsible for initial deliverable review and collaboration with the consultants on the project and then enables the QA review process before delivering the project to the customer contacts. As both a leader/mentor and as a billable resource - participate in customer engagements to ensure standards for technical execution are being adhered to and less seasoned consultants are being groomed for success within their role. Compensation Analyst - Atlanta, GA or Overland Park, KS
Oldcastle, Overland Park
Job ID: 494527CRH is a leading global diversified building materials group, employing over 75,800 people at more than 3,160 locations in 29 countries. CRH is the leading building materials company in North America and the world. We manufacture and distribute a diverse range of superior building materials, products, and solutions, which are used extensively in construction projects of all sizes. Position OverviewCRH Americas, Inc., is seeking a Compensation Analyst to help ensure the external competitiveness and internal equity of the company's compensation programs through market pricing, job evaluation, and data management/analysis. The role will also support a range of annual processes and projects such as the annual compensation cycle, executive compensation data management, hourly compensation analysis, and ad hoc reporting. This role reports to the Director, Compensation & Reward for CRH Americas.CRH plc, based in Dublin, Ireland, is the leading building materials company in the world, and in 2023, its Americas operations generated revenues of $22.5 billion and employed approximately 46,400 in the U.S., Canada, and Mexico.This position is either based in Atlanta, GA or Overland Park, KS or Remote.Key Responsibilities (Essential Duties and Functions)To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ily.1. Market Pricing/Market Trends Assist in market pricing jobs using multiple survey sources as part of projects and on an ad hoc basis. Organize the market data in a logical manner to communicate findings. 2. Data Management/Analysis Support the maintenance of data in various systems to enable multiple compensation processes (annual compensation cycle, executive compensation processes, internal equity analysis, audits, etc.). Supports the Reward Team as we work with HR to support the annual compensation review cycle, specifically around data quality, data checking, data collection, and data input to our systems. Compile data from multiple systems to research and respond to data requests (leadership requests, ongoing analysis of employee populations, compliance, etc.). 3. Business Partnering Provide guidance and assistance to HR on current compensation processes, procedures, and policies. Provide support and guidance to HR and hiring managers around offer letters and promotions to support company objectives for recruiting, retention, and employee engagement. 4. Presentations/Communication Support the development and delivery of communications to support the compensation function throughout the year, including webinars, email communications, and feedback surveys. Support the overall planning and execution of the annual global compensation review cycle including preparing material, such as presentation decks (PowerPoint), calendars, and other visuals showing key dates and actions to be taken. Qualifications Education/Experience Bachelor's degree in human resources, finance, business, or a related field. 2+ years of experience working in human resources, finance, business in a mid-large corporate environment. Sr. Corporate Counsel
Optiv Security, Overland Park
The Sr. Corporate Counsel is responsible for a variety of legal business matters that range from developing legal terms, managing claims and litigation, overseeing contract guidelines/review of corporate counsel, negotiating vendor terms, managing and administering equity programs and advising the organization on appropriate legal action to be taken. How you'll make an impactWorking with corporate in-house counsel, draft, review and negotiate legal and commercial documents and contracts, including master services agreements, RFPs, non-disclosure agreements, purchase agreements, reseller agreements, leases, and employment agreements. Coordinate results of such documentation reviews with sales representatives, department directors and help negotiate satisfactory outcomes with client and partners. Works closely with outside counsel and with many of the company's other in-house lawyers, sales, operations and finance staff, as well as service delivery teams Oversees legal equity database and administration of company stock option grants Represent the organization on legal matters as assigned. Perform factual and legal research and analysis, draft and review contracts, data privacy and protection, employment agreements, and other legal correspondence. Advise executives on potential legal ramifications of proposed organizational policies and procedures. Protect the organization's rights in its interactions with external parties. Oversees company's legal response in job related workplace disputes or claims of employer wrongdoing (e.g., wrongful termination, contract disagreements, unemployment issues, and discrimination) Responsible for a broad array of legal matters, which may include: regulatory, employment, insurance claims, business development, contracts, mergers & acquisitions, real estate, data privacy and protection, environmental, litigation, and commercial issues Oversees our Equity and insurance Portfolio program Assisting the General Counsel in preparing Optiv to comply with the SEC rules and regulations What we're looking forLaw degree and license to practice law, At least 7-15 years of experience practicing law, including in the area of contract review and negotiation, preferably in both private practice and corporate settings.
